Board:

You’ve tried. No one can argue against that.
It’s going to be hard to give up this position as you will never have it again
But you must look in the mirror and ask yourself whether you need this.
Do the right thing, have an honest review of your errors and whether new blood is needed to try and turn this thing around.
Wrexham is bigger than any sense of failure or bruised ego you may endure.
You let the rot set in by abandoning and allowing poor performance and failure in the non 1st team areas, what you didn’t realise is rot spreads once it’s allowed in. Standards have to be high everywhere, everyone has to be working 100% towards the goal, not just some people.
It’s now too late, only new vision and drive can reverse the decline.

WST:

Your aims were commendable, the intentions honourable but you have forgotten the community you were intended to serve, a football club exists to support the entire community associated with the club, not a politically active few. You have failed to bring board members to account for activities that should never, ever, be tolerated. It’s time to be pragmatic, to realise the peril of the situation is far greater than the purity of the politics clung tenaciously onto by the few who still believe it’s the only way forward. Do the right thing, engage widely, look outwards not inwards for those who can help.

You can no longer sit and hope. You must act. Show some humility, some pragmatism and for gods sake show some fight and character - if you do maybe the players will.
